Solubilities of 2-(2-Hydroxyphenyl)phenylphosphonic Acid in Chlorobenzene and in Water and Partition Coefficient between Water + Chlorobenzene Mixtures

Wang, S.-B.[Shu-Bo], Wang, L. -S.[Li-Sheng]
J. Chem. Eng. Data 2005, 50, 6, 1944-1946
ABSTRACT
The solubilities of 2-(2-hydroxyphenyl)phenylphosphonic acid (HBP) in chlorobenzene (300.97 to 355.30) K and in water (308.6 to 362.37) K and partition coefficient between water + chlorobenzene mixtures were measured. The partition coefficients of HBP were measured between water + chlorobenzene immiscible mixtures from (299.45 to 334.05) K.
